Die Legende vom Regenbogenmann (Nino Kerl)Der Maler Antonio lebt mit seinem tierischen Freund, dem Spatz Vivaldi, in Wolkenbruch. Dort regnet es tagein, tagaus. Eines Tages findet Antonio keinen Platz mehr fr seine Kunst. Da kommt den beiden die Idee, den grauen Himmel wie eine Leinwand zu nutzen.
